    A screened porch is a partially enclosed outdoor space that uses screens instead of walls to keep out insects while allowing for airflow and natural light. These porches can be attached to the main house or built as standalone structures, providing a versatile area for relaxation, dining, or entertaining.

    Planning Your Screened Porch: Key Considerations

    Before diving into design ideas, it’s crucial to plan your screened porch thoughtfully. Here are some key considerations:

    • Size: Determine the dimensions based on available space and intended use. A larger porch is ideal for entertaining, while a smaller one may suffice for quiet evenings.
    • Location: Choose a spot that maximizes views and sunlight while considering privacy and accessibility.
    • Permits: Check local building codes and obtain necessary permits to avoid complications during construction.
    • Materials: Select durable materials that withstand weather conditions, such as treated wood, composite materials, or metal frames.

    Screened Porch Flooring Options

    The flooring of your screened porch plays a crucial role in its overall look and functionality. Here are some popular choices along with their pros and cons:

    Wood

    • Pros: Aesthetic appeal, natural warmth, and easy to customize.
    • Cons: Requires regular maintenance and can be slippery when wet.

    Composite Decking

    • Pros: Low maintenance, resistant to rot, and available in various colors.
    • Cons: Can be more expensive than wood and may fade over time.

    Tile

    • Pros: Durable, easy to clean, and available in numerous designs.
    • Cons: Can be cold underfoot and may require professional installation.

    Concrete

    • Pros: Extremely durable, customizable with stains or stamps.
    • Cons: Can crack over time and may require sealing.

    Outdoor Rugs

    • Pros: Easy to change, adds comfort, and can define spaces.
    • Cons: Requires regular cleaning and may fade in direct sunlight.
